Slab addition services involve extending or enlarging existing concrete slabs to accommodate new structures, expand living space, or improve functionality. This process typically includes preparing the existing slab, pouring new concrete sections, and ensuring a seamless transition between the old and new surfaces. Homeowners may choose to add a slab for various reasons, such as creating a larger patio, building an outdoor living area, or adding a foundation for a new structure like a garage or shed. Skilled service providers focus on delivering durable, level, and visually consistent results that integrate smoothly with the existing concrete.
This service helps address common problems related to insufficient space, uneven surfaces, or deteriorated concrete that no longer meets the needs of the property. For example, a cracked or uneven slab can pose safety hazards or hinder usability, prompting homeowners to seek professional repair or expansion. Additionally, properties with aging or damaged slabs may benefit from an extension to reinforce stability or to prepare for future construction projects. By adding new concrete sections, homeowners can improve the safety, appearance, and functionality of their outdoor areas or foundation systems.

The overview below groups typical Slab Addition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Minneapolis, MN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or slab additions or patching,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for simple repairs or small-scale modifications.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, depending on scope.
Standard Additions - Mid-sized slab addition services us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These projects often include extending existing slabs or adding new sections for driveways or patios.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of this range unless significant excavation or reinforcement is needed.
Full Replacement - Complete slab replacements generally range from $4,000 to $8,000, with larger or more intricate jobs potentially exceeding this. Many local service providers handle projects in this price band, especially for extensive or heavily reinforced slabs.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ly detailed or large-scale slab additions can cost $10,000 or more, particularly for custom designs or challenging sites. Such projects are less common and tend to fall into the highest cost ranges based on complexity and materials required.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

In other cases, property owners may require a new concrete slab after renovations or to repair existing damage caused by Minnesota’s seasonal freeze-thaw cycles. Local service providers can assist with replacing or extending existing slabs for driveways, walkways, or basement floors. Such work helps ensure safety and durability, especially in areas prone to shifting or cracking over time.
